This one-day Zen retreat is designed for those seeking a break from the busy modern world, set in a beautiful Zen temple in Yamanashi. While the temple can be difficult to reach by public transportation, it is easily accessible via a private bus from Shinjuku, taking you to a serene location far from the hustle and bustle of the city.
Experience Zazen (Zen meditation) in the crisp, dignified atmosphere, enjoy calming matcha green tea, and savor a Shojin Ryori (Buddhist vegetarian cuisine) lunch that engages all five senses. Simply sitting and listening to the sounds of wind and water will help quiet and clear your mind.

Erin-ji Temple
Upon arrival at the historic Erinji Temple, enjoy a cup of traditional matcha tea. In the serene atmosphere, this quiet moment helps shift your focus inward and gently prepares your mind for Zazen (Zen meditation).
30 minutes
3
Erin-ji Temple
Experience Zazen (Zen meditation) in a peaceful, historic setting. Rather than trying to empty your mind, simply sit and observe—listening to the sounds of nature, such as the wind and flowing water.
The session is divided into three shorter periods, making it accessible even for beginners, allowing you to gradually deepen your focus and sense of calm.
1 heure et 30 minutes
4
Erin-ji Temple
Enjoy a Shojin Ryori lunch as a mindful dining experience.
Before the meal, you will be introduced to the Gokan-no-ge (Five Reflections), a traditional Buddhist practice expressing gratitude for the food. You will also experience a few moments of silent eating.
Through this mindful approach—savoring each bite slowly—you can restore balance to both body and mind.
